In an age where entertainment is readily accessible, does the ease of access always equate to legality and ethical consumption? The proliferation of websites offering free access to copyrighted content poses a significant challenge to the film industry, raising questions about piracy, copyright infringement, and the future of cinema itself.
The digital landscape is constantly evolving, and with it, the ways in which we consume media. Platforms like Movierulz, a name synonymous with the unauthorized distribution of films, have become increasingly prevalent. Offering a vast library of movies spanning various languages, including Hindi, English, Tamil, Telugu, Kannada, Marathi, and Punjabi, these sites attract a large audience by providing content without any associated cost. This, however, comes at a steep price, not only for the film industry but also for the creative individuals involved in bringing these stories to life.
The allure of instant gratification and free access is a strong one. However, it's crucial to understand the implications of supporting such platforms. When a film is illegally downloaded or streamed, the creators, actors, and all the people involved in its production are denied their rightful earnings. This ultimately affects the quality and quantity of future films, as studios and individuals become hesitant to invest in projects that risk being pirated.
Consider the Kannada film industry, a vibrant and growing sector of Indian cinema. In 2022, Kannada cinema witnessed a surge in both box office hits and critically acclaimed movies. Films like "Vikrant Rona" and "777 Charlie" garnered significant attention and recognition. These successes demonstrate the potential of Kannada cinema to captivate audiences, both nationally and internationally. However, this growth is perpetually threatened by the prevalence of piracy. Websites like Movierulz and Tamilrockers continue to pose a serious threat by illegally distributing these movies, often soon after their theatrical releases.
The issue extends beyond the financial aspects. Piracy also damages the artistic integrity of films. Illegal copies are often of poor quality, sometimes with substandard audio or video, and may lack subtitles or other crucial elements. This detracts from the intended viewing experience and undermines the creators' artistic vision.

The fight against piracy is multifaceted, requiring a combined effort from legal bodies, content creators, and consumers. Law enforcement agencies are actively working to shut down illegal websites, but their efforts are often reactive rather than proactive. The websites adapt by changing domain names and server locations.
Content creators are actively seeking ways to make their content more accessible and appealing to audiences through legitimate channels. This includes providing access to movies on multiple platforms, releasing movies simultaneously in theaters and on streaming services, and exploring innovative payment models.
Consumers have a pivotal role to play. By supporting legitimate channels, they send a clear message that they value the hard work of the film industry and the creative individuals involved. They also help to create a sustainable ecosystem for the continued growth and evolution of cinema.
